Bastille, Paloma Faith, Damon Albarn and more feature on charity cover of A Million Dreams

Ravi's Dream

Bastille’s Dan Smith, Paloma Faith, Jimmy Somerville, Metronomy’s Joseph Mount and Damon Albarn are among the musicians featured on a new cover of the song ‘A Million Dreams’ from ‘The Greatest Showman’. The new track is being released in aid of The Brain Tumour Charity and Brainstrust, and was the idea of seven year old Ravi Adelekan – son of Metronomy bassist Olugbenga Adelekan – who was diagnosed with a brain tumour last year.

Ravi’s illness was initially diagnosed as a build up of ear wax but, when an ear, nose and throat specialist requested an MRI scan, a tumour was discovered on his brain stem. Although later discovered to be benign, the tumour was still life threatening and required ten hours of surgery.

After a lengthy period of recovery, Ravi came up with the idea of recording a song to raise money for the two charities that had supported him during this time. Olugbenga got in touch with a range of musicians and other public figures and pulled together the track, which is being released as part of a project called Ravi’s Dream.

As well as the musicians who feature on the track itself, the accompanying video also includes appearances from ‘The Greatest Showman’ star Hugh Jackman and director Michael Gracey, plus Coldplay, Mary Berry, NASA astronaut Chris Cassidy, Abba’s Björn Ulvaeus, actor John Simm, food critic Jimi Famurewa, De La Soul, Heather Watson and footballer Leandro Trossard.

“Every day, we speak with families who are lost, alone and afraid following a brain tumour diagnosis”, says Helen Bulbeck, founder of Brainstrust. “The treatment is harmful; diagnosis hard and too often too slow. Outcomes for this forgotten community are short of where they need to be, and life is too hard for people who are having to adapt to life with this disease”.

“Ravi’s Dream is helping us change this”, she continues. “Ravi’s dream team is bringing vital momentum, funds and awareness of the challenges we face, and our work here at Brainstrust. His music is giving our community a voice that will be heard at all levels to drive the changes we need to see”.
